Paris

We visited Paris for a week in February 2008 to celebrate our 6th wedding anniversary. We used reward points to book our hotel in the 8th arrondissement - by no means a tourist area, but good for us because it was free. In addition to roaming the streets of Paris, visiting museums, and searching out good food, we made a couple of day trips to Versailles and the Loire Valley to visit the chateaux. While there, I found the trip to be much more difficult than our previous visit to Rome because of the language barrier, but in hindsight it was less problematic than it felt at the time. Now I'm obsessed with the idea of going back in the coming years, and doing all those things that we didn't get to do, or revisiting our favorites.
